EU prepares to extend sanctions by one year

Brussels, 10/02/2010 (Agence Europe) - The European Union is preparing to extend the two types of sanction imposed on Zimbabwe since 2002 by one year. With insufficient progress having been made by Zimbabwe in implementing the comprehensive political agreement concluded in September, member states' ambassadors to the EU (COREPER) gave their approval, on Wednesday 10 February, to the extension until 20 February 2011 of appropriate measures restricting development cooperation with that country (under the terms of Article 96 of the Cotonou Agreement), and of targeted sanctions imposed under the CFSP on a group of people and companies close to Robert Mugabe and on Mugabe himself (freezing of assets, visa restrictions) duly listed. Only a small number of people have been withdrawn from the list. The formal decision will be taken, without debate, on 16 February on the sidelines of the Ecofin Council. (A.N./transl.rt)
